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Patient with CME after uncomplicated cataract surgery completing informed consent form to participate in the study
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Patients with diabetic retinopathy, retinal and vascular patients, patients with macular Patients with severe renal insufficiency, hepatic insufficiency, etc. are excluded from the study.degeneration are excluded from the study to control confounding variables. All patients admitted to the study can withdraw from the study at any time from the start of the study.
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Macular thickness. Timepoint: Treatment will continue for up to 2 months after starting treatment. If CME improves before this time, the patient will be examined for up to 8 weeks. The studied variables were patient vision before starting and 2, 4, 8 weeks after starting treatment, IOP before starting and 2, 4, 8 weeks after starting treatment and macular thickness before starting treatment and 2, 4 and 8 weeks after From the beginning of treatment. Method of measurement: Oct device and Goldman tonometer. | — |
